Here's a lovely Japanese Christmas card (also from Tyne & Wear Archives & Museums), sent from Lieutenant Akemoto to James Donnelly, who was a foreman at Armstrong's Elswick shipyard. When Lieutenant Akemoto came to Newcastle to inspect naval guns being built by Armstrong, he stayed with James Donnelly and his family. After his return to Japan, he kept in touch with his hosts and sent them postcards and gifts from time to time. www.imagine.org.uk/details/index.php?id=TWCMS:1994.194.1&...
